Intellectual Asset Management

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Intellectual Asset Management (IAM) is a bimonthly[1] magazine published in English and focused on "intellectual property from a business point of view".[1] Its publisher is Globe White Page Ltd, and, as of 2010, its editorial board included former Corporate VP for IP at Microsoft, Marshall Phelps.[1] Its tagline is "Maximising IP value for business".[2] Its first issue was published in 2003 (July/August 2003 issue).[3]

IAM is one of the publications produced by The IP Media Group, which was formed in 2008.[4] The group also publishes World Trademark Review, a magazine for trademark specialists, organizes the IP Business Congress and runs the IP Hall of Fame.
